Robertson Cambridge University Press, 1991 M03 21 - 264 pages These two volumes contain selected papers presented at the international conference on group theory held at St. Andrews in 1989. The themes of the conference were combinatorial and computational group theory; leading group theorists, including J.A. Green, N.D. Gupta, O.H. Kegel and J.G. Thompson, gave courses whose content is reproduced here. Also included are refereed papers presented at the meeting. |
